摘要

In order to analyze the distribution characteristics of lead,the paper takes surface sediments in collapse lake in Yangzhuang coal mine Huai Bei as the research object.Data are statistical analyzed by SPSS17.0.The results showed that the total lead concentration in surface sediments distribute spatial variation.The total lead concentration in northwest collapse lake is higher than that of central and eastern collapse lake,having the significant difference (P<0.05).Possible lead sources were mine waste water discharge,coal gangue pile of long-term leaching.The BCR sequential extraction showed that residual fractions>oxidizable fractions>reductive fractions>acetic acid fractions.Pb was dominated mainly by the fraction of residual Pb,and lower acetic acid fractions.The results indicated that lead bioavailability was low.
